Output 266efc9ef1fbd67b214c104dec7157ae8cae8533f6b4a0959998d907eacf937a:0

value
38605000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4baf565dc87f891a128788bf421a424a17027e0 OP_EQUALVERIFY OP_CHECKSIG
address
1LPpDn9DPWe5aVPoMQD7e4yo2WTJW6aePN
transaction
266efc9ef1fbd67b214c104dec7157ae8cae8533f6b4a0959998d907eacf937a
confirmations
559892
spent
true